I don't have the book, and probably won't get to it this month. However,
the suggestion is a good one, and Lou should start that discussion. I've said
previously that this aspect of James's theory was both the most innovative
and, among his followers, the least fruitful (to Chairman Marty's perpetual
consternation), which requires both exploration and explanation. CLR's
anti-vanguardist viewpoint represents his greatest departure from his
Trotskyist roots, but that aspect looks better than ever in light of all the
failed vanguards that dot the political landscape.
Though it may not be so evident, this does relate directly to the
previous thread, because it was CLR's and Marty's theories of organization
that led them to embrace the New Left, particularly SDS, when the rest of the
Old Left was turning its back on the upstart movement.
